Product Description:
The Rexroth Indramat makes the KDA 3.2-100-3-APS-W1 AC main spindle drive that can handle speeds within ±10 V and has an extra input for a 1 V sine encoder. The stable operation is supported by the heatsink and blower assembly's configuration, which allows for efficient heat dissipation. Under constant load, the forced cooling system keeps the temperature stable.
The dimensions of the KDA 3.2-100-3-APS-W1 spindle drive are 525 mm in height, 390 mm in width, and 355 mm in depth. The width of the heatsink is 160 mm when it is not equipped with an air duct and 185 mm when it is equipped with an air duct. The depth of the air duct is 25 mm. The horizontal mounting hole distances are 345 mm, and the vertical mounting hole distances are 160 mm. The dimensions of the blower unit are 169 mm in width and 88 mm in depth. There is an 80 mm gap between the blower and the enclosure. A 185 mm wide air duct is available. The blower, with the mounting frame, has a total height of 490 mm.
The main spindle drive AC uses 300 V and has a current rating of 100 A. The blower unit is 4.2 kg in weight, while the mounting accessories are 1.7 kg. For forced cooling, the drive makes use of a 115 V AC supply voltage at 50-60 Hz for the heatsink fan. The standard power infrastructure compatibility is guaranteed by the supply voltage standards.
